They absolutely were taking contracts a few months back in the $130s but also fewer people started buying SSR at that price for fear of ROFR and competitive value. Contracts started sitting longer, inventories began to build and prices dropped to what we are seeing now. Transferred points can’t be borrowed. And ,you can’t transfer 2024 points until you enter your 2023 UY.

Nope. They will not transfer the points if already borrowed. I tried that not too long ago.

They will allow more than one transfer for the same owners and even have let banked points be transferred within the same owner.

They are pretty strict and consistent with the borrowed points. I am going to lose 2 points in my June UY because they would transfer the 20 borrowed points I had and the room I booked was 18.
